Light Amplification by Stimulated Emission of Radiation (commonly: "LASER") was discovered on Earth in the early 20th century. Most lasers use a form of crystal or gas in which the electrons have been raised to an excited state. Mirrors are then used to reflect stray photons back and forth through this medium, provoking a cascade reaction that releases a burst of light. The beam emitted from a laser is monochromatic, coherent, and has a very high intensity. High-energy lasers are thus able to focus large amounts of energy onto very small areas, which can result in considerable physical damage.


Lasers have a variety of uses in medicine, computers, mining and power generation (such as fusion reactors) and came into widespread use as a weapon during the mid-21st Century.


Lasers remained in widespread use for some two hundred years, and weas the main armament of the Constitution class starships during the early years of the Federation. By 2255 the standard issue hand laser was capable of blasting through considerable thickness of rock. A larger artillery style ground cannon could provide heavy fire - this weapon could be rigged to run from remote power sources if required, supplying sufficient power to blast half a continent.


Between 2255 and 2265, lasers where replaced in Star Fleet service with the much superior phasers.
Today, lasers are not a significant ship-to-ship weapon, as the navigational shields of a Federation starship are immune to this form of energy.
